Python和C++哪个简单?

简介

Python和C++哪个简单?

Python和C++是两种流行的编程语言,但在学习的难易程度上却有显著差异。本文将深入比较这两种语言的语法、特性和学习曲线,以确定哪种语言更易于掌握。JS转Excel!

语法比较

Python以其简单易学的语法而闻名。它使用缩进和英语关键字来创建可读性强的代码,从而降低了学习的门槛。例如:

“`python王利头.

print(“Hello, world!”)
“`

相比之下,C++的语法更为复杂,具有较多的符号、关键字和语句结构。它要求开发人员对内存管理和指针等底层概念有更深入的了解。例如:王利.

“`cpp

using namespace std;wanglitou.

int main() {
cout << “Hello, world!” << endl;
return 0;
}
“`

特性比较

Python是一种解释型语言,这意味着它的代码在运行时被逐行执行。它具有广泛的库,可用于各种任务,例如数据科学、机器学习和网络开发。

C++是一种编译型语言,这意味着它在运行之前将代码转换为机器代码。它以其高性能和内存效率而闻名,并广泛用于游戏开发、嵌入式系统和高性能计算。批量打开网址?

学习曲线

Python的学习曲线相对平缓,尤其适合初学者或非计算机科学专业人士。其直观的语法和丰富的资源使其易于入门。

C++的学习曲线陡峭,特别是对于没有编程经验的人。它的复杂语法和底层概念需要大量时间和精力来掌握。HTML在线运行,

难易度评估

基于语法、特性和学习曲线,我们得出以下结论:在线字数统计?

  • 对于初学者和非计算机科学专业人士:Python更简单,因为它具有易于学习的语法、丰富的库和较低的学习门槛。
  • 对于有编程经验的人:C++可能更简单,因为它的编译型特性提供了更高的性能和内存效率。但是,学习C++需要有较强的编程基础。

问答

  1. 哪种语言更适合数据科学? Python,因为它有广泛的数据科学库。
  2. 哪种语言更适合游戏开发? C++,因为它提供更高的性能和对底层系统的控制。
  3. 哪种语言更容易学习? Python,因为它具有直观的语法和较低的学习门槛。
  4. 哪种语言更适合初学者? Python,因为它更易于理解和使用。
  5. 哪种语言更适合有经验的程序员? C++,因为它提供了更高的控制和性能。
相关阅读:  .net开发和python开发的区别
SEO!wangli.

原创文章,作者:孔飞欣,如若转载,请注明出处:https://www.wanglitou.cn/article_87743.html

(0)
打赏 微信扫一扫 微信扫一扫
上一篇 2024-06-26 00:17
下一篇 2024-06-26 00:21

相关推荐

公众号